Hosts: Barry, Mike, Zeth & Harry
They're back, in what has been the podcast's most consistent run for quite a while. Newly minted Editor-in-Chief Zeth makes a return to a show in which they discuss new games like Kingdoms Of Amalur: Reckoning and Saints Row: The Third, new versions of old games like Dizzy, and old versions of old games like Syndicate. In addition, the team discuss 3DS vs. Vita, Barry's annoyances with DLC, the rumours about the next Xbox, Nintendo's NFC and their reported losses. All this and more on the 86th episode of the Brutal Gamer Podcast.
